#noscript {
	position:fixed;
	top:0;
	left:0;
	width:100%;
	z-index:2000;
	text-align:center;
	
}
#noscript p {
	display:inline-block;
	border:1px #f00 solid;
	padding:5px;
	background:#fff;
}
#wrapper {
width:1024px;
}

#banner h1 {
    position: absolute;
    top: 180px;
    left: 2%;
	right: 2%;
    font-size: 30px;
    font-weight: normal;
    color: #05559a;
	display:block;
}

#banner p {
    position: absolute;
    left: 2%;
    top: 224px;
    font-size: 18px;
    color: #05559a;
	display:block;
}
#meta-footer p {
padding:0 0 4px 0;
}
body.jsdisabled .item:hover .level_2_bg {
    top:68px;
    width: 100%;
    background-color: rgba(250, 250, 250, 0.95);
    position: absolute;
    left: 0;
	border-bottom: 1px solid #333;
	overflow:auto;
}

body.jsdisabled #header #nav-header nav  li:hover .level_2, body.jsdisabled #header #nav-header nav  li.sfhover .level_2 {
display:block;
}

body.jsdisabled #nav-header .item:hover span, body.jsdisabled #nav-header .item:hover a {
    border-bottom: 4px solid #eb1d5d;
    padding-bottom: 3px;
}

body.jsdisabled #nav-header .item:hover .level_2 span, body.jsdisabled #nav-header .item:hover .level_2 a {
    border-bottom: 0;
    padding-bottom: 0;
}